Transaction ef4a23b99cedbe3fa4b63319fdd3cb5479f8cc25eb4951c49432ffd36a1826e1
1 Input
1 Output
-
ef4a23b99cedbe3fa4b63319fdd3cb5479f8cc25eb4951c49432ffd36a1826e1:0
- value
- 49307156
- script pubkey
- OP_0 OP_PUSHBYTES_20 07165bbe97ef80f5f62babd948ec1cd2220ddcaf
- address
- bc1qqut9h05ha7q0ta3t40v53mqu6g3qmh90u8e2tf